Just some thoughts on the 'three strikes and you're out' proposed law change. Firstly Hide says it will be a deterrent. I would be surprised. I don’t think the criminal mind works like that and overseas examples have not supported that rationale. Fair enough, though, there does seem to be some appetite for getting tough on law and order.
What really troubles me is Rodney Hide. Is it just me or do others struggle with him as a credible figure these days?
Once the perk buster was found to be gallivanting around the world with his partner, in my mind, he completely lost his moral mandate to talk about right and wrong and improving society. To me, the guy who sold himself as a man of principle now appears to be passing time until he is rightfully sent into oblivion. So to see him going on about law and order and building a better society to me seems laughable.
